The Impact Of Medical Device Animation In Healthcare

Animation has become an invaluable tool in the healthcare industry, especially when it comes to explaining complex medical devices and their functions. medical device animation has revolutionized the way healthcare professionals communicate with patients, colleagues, and even investors. By breaking down complicated concepts into easily digestible visuals, animations help bridge the gap between scientific jargon and layman’s terms, ultimately improving patient understanding and outcomes.

One of the key benefits of medical device animation is its ability to simplify complex concepts. Medical devices and procedures can be incredibly intricate and difficult to understand, especially for patients with little to no medical background. By using animation, healthcare professionals can visually illustrate how a medical device works, its benefits, and potential risks in a clear and engaging manner. This not only helps patients make informed decisions about their treatment options but also increases their confidence in the healthcare provider.

Moreover, medical device animation can be used to train healthcare professionals on how to use new equipment or perform procedures. Traditional training methods, such as manuals or demonstrations, can be time-consuming and not as effective in conveying complex information. By utilizing animations, healthcare professionals can learn at their own pace, pause and rewind as needed, and gain a deeper understanding of the device or procedure. This ultimately leads to increased proficiency and confidence in their practice.

In addition, medical device animation plays a crucial role in marketing and sales efforts within the healthcare industry. Companies that manufacture medical devices often rely on animations to showcase the features and benefits of their products to potential buyers. By creating visually appealing and informative animations, companies can effectively demonstrate how their devices work, highlight their unique selling points, and showcase the benefits to the end-user. This not only helps drive sales but also boosts brand awareness and credibility in the market.

One of the most significant advantages of medical device animation is its ability to visualize the unseen. Some medical devices operate internally or have intricate mechanisms that are not visible to the naked eye. Animation can bridge this gap by creating realistic depictions of how the device functions within the body or in a clinical setting. This helps patients and healthcare professionals better understand the device’s purpose, operation, and potential outcomes, ultimately leading to improved decision-making and patient care.

Furthermore, medical device animation can be a valuable tool for patient education and informed consent. Patients often feel overwhelmed by complex medical information and terminology, making it challenging for them to grasp the implications of a proposed treatment or procedure. By using animations, healthcare providers can simplify the information, address common misconceptions, and empower patients to make informed decisions about their healthcare. This not only enhances patient satisfaction but also reduces the risk of miscommunication and litigation.

As technology continues to advance, the potential applications of medical device animation are limitless. Virtual reality (VR) and augmented reality (AR) technologies are increasingly being used in healthcare to provide immersive and interactive experiences for patients and healthcare professionals. These technologies can be combined with medical device animations to create realistic simulations of surgical procedures, medical device implantations, and disease progression, allowing for enhanced training, patient education, and treatment planning.
